ichidan verb, intransitive verb
lose one's nerve; feel daunted
Almost always used in the set phrase 気が引ける, meaning to feel hesitant, self-conscious, or unable to act freely.
See also: 気が引ける (きがひける)
みんなの前で話すのは気が引ける。
I feel daunted about speaking in front of everyone.
彼に頼みごとをするのは気が引ける。
I feel hesitant to ask him a favor.
